Transaction 5de74257cc4b9ffd80668b477d3fc59c2d4aebc9040cb5707a5e155cf8e0c37e
2 Input
2 Outputs
- 5de74257cc4b9ffd80668b477d3fc59c2d4aebc9040cb5707a5e155cf8e0c37e:0
- 5de74257cc4b9ffd80668b477d3fc59c2d4aebc9040cb5707a5e155cf8e0c37e:1
value 5675618
address 19z59t1fabLgePvDXn9MgVVbBZUU92KAiU
value 13908941
address 1JeMMDZX12qvTn1QWfRuQrcHNijqLYws93